About the Event

The Florida Career Centers invites your organization to participate in the 2026 Virtual Statewide Job Fair! This premier event offers employers the exclusive opportunity to engage with graduates and alumni from all twelve state universities in Florida.

With over 150 employers and more than 1,000 students and alumni in attendance, this job fair is a prime platform for recruiting candidates for co-ops, internships, and full-time, professional positions.

Statewide Job Fair FAQs (Employers):

How can my organization participate in the Virtual Statewide Job Fair?

Employers can learn more about the Statewide Job Fair and register with the link provided on this page.

What are the benefits of participating in the Statewide Job Fair for employers?

Through the Statewide Job Fair, employers have access to a broad talent pool comprising students and alumni from all 12 state universities, all in one dynamic event. Additionally, you will receive 1 Hour Early Access to Review Resumes of RSVP’d Students.

In what system is the Statewide Job Fair hosted?

The Statewide Job Fair is hosted in Symplicity.

How many recruiters can attend the Statewide Job Fair from my company?

There is no limit to the number of recruiters that can participate from your organization.

Can employers from outside of Florida participate in the job fair?

Yes! We welcome all employers with job, internship, and other experiential learning opportunities to participate in the Statewide Job Fair.

How does the virtual format of the job fair work, and what technology will be used?

Employers need only a computer with a webcam and internet access to participate. Interactions between employers and participants will be primarily through 1:1 video chats. For Symplicity student tutorials.

How can employers maximize their recruitment efforts and engagement with attendees during the virtual event?

Employers can maximize their recruitment efforts by actively promoting their participation in the Statewide Job Fair through social media and other marketing channels. A clear and compelling presentation of the opportunities available at your company is important to drawing participants’ interest.

Additionally, following up with interested candidates promptly after the event can further solidify connections and facilitate the recruitment process.

Your Source for Talent

The FCC is an ad hoc group of Career Services Directors from 12 public universities in the State of Florida. The FCC meets monthly virtually and 3 times per year, throughout the State, collaborating with area employers who host the meetings and coordinate “networking” presentations and discussion.
